Job Duties
  • Responsible for laying up, feeding or piling down materials at equipment
  • Jog product off counter stacker and stack neatly on skid to assure good running in bindery or mailing department.
  • Complete skid flags and packaging slips to ensure accurate tracking
  • Install strapping, bracing, or padding to prevent shifting or damage in transit, using hand tools
  • Attaches identifying tags or labels to materials or marks information on cases, bales, or other containers
  • Stacks or assembles materials into bundles and bands bundles together, using banding machine and clincher
  • May use automated equipment and/or occasionally operate industrial truck or electric hoist to assist in loading or moving materials and products.
Qualifications
  • Able to stock, move, arrange, and rotate items in accordance with operating instructions
  • Able to complete appropriate forms relating to stock description, quantity, unit of issue, and the labeling requirements for incoming and outgoing materials
  • Good skill in the use of shrink-wrap and strapping equipment, powered lift equipment, pallet jacks, manual dollies, carts or hand trucks and hand tools used in material handling tasks such as hammers, pliers, strapping and stretch wrapping tools and equipment, tape fasteners, metal band sheers and related equipment
  • Good knowledge of general warehouse layout, item identification codes, basic warehouse procedures, and the storage areas in order to be able to place or pull paper stock, signatures and materials in accordance with standard procedures
  • May require experience in operating/using forklift truck
